Problem 2 - Ratio and financial analysis (20 points)
Directions: Using the financial data provided below, compute the following ratios, round to two decimal places, and show all supporting work typed out or as an Excel formula.
Assets
Cash $ 125,000
Short-term investments $ 50,000
Accounts receivable $ 200,000
Merchandise inventory $ 150,000
Prepaid expenses $ 10,000
Property, Plant and Equipment (net) $ 965,000
Liabilities and Stockholders Equity
Accounts payable $ 210,000
Notes payable (due in 6 months) $ 40,000
Accrued liabilities (all short term) $ 10,000
Bonds payable, 10%, (due in 10 years) $ 250,000
Common stock, $20 par, 25,000 shares $ 500,000
Paid-in capital in excess of par $ 40,000
Retained earnings $ 450,000
Selected Data
Average accounts receivable $ 175,000
Average merchandise inventory $ 130,000
Average stockholders equity $ 900,000
Average total assets $ 1,400,000
Cash dividends paid on common stock $ 75,000
Cost of goods sold $ 950,000
Income before income tax $ 180,000
Interest expense $ 25,000
Net income $ 120,000
Net sales $ 1,600,000
Common stock, market price at Dec 31 $72.00
Part 1: complete the ratio calculation
Ratio required Supporting work required (type here or use an Excel forumula) Final answer
0. Ratio of fixed assets to long-term liabilities =965000/250000 3.86
1. Quick ratio
2. Current ratio
3. Inventory turnover
4. Accounts receivable turnover
5. Return on total assets
6. Return on stockholders equity
7. Times interest earned
8. Earnings per share on common stock
9. Price-earnings ratio on common stock
10. Dividend yield on common stock
Part 2: comment on how this business is doing based on the above ratio analysis
